Hawaiian Tropical Shrublands: An Endangered Ecosystem is happening at Keālia Wildlife Refuge on Friday, July 19th. Hosted by Friends of Keālia Pond National Wildlife Refuge, guests are invited to attend and understand more about Hawaiian shrublands. Learn about a threatened ecosystem that consists of endemic Hawaiian plants and wildlife like the Hawaiian Coot.
